    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

    Asbestos lawyers are committed to helping families and victims receive the financial compensation they need and deserve. They are employed by national firms which have access to asbestos databases and have a track record of winning important cases and settlements.

    They assist mesothelioma sufferers to file a person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it against the companies that caused their exposure. Most cases are settled before trial.

    Obtaining an appropriate settlement

    An asbestos lawyer with experience is necessary to get fair compensation in a mesothelioma settlement lawsuit. They will review the case in depth and ensure they have the right evidence to support the settlement or trial to be successful. They will also help the plaintiff and their family members obtain any necessary medical care. These services are usually covered by workers' compensation insurance, so the victim can get them for free.

    An attorney will gather all the relevant information regarding the asbestos-related illness including dates and locations of exposure. The attorney will then send this information to the defendant and wait for their response. The defendant might attempt to deny the claims or offer a lower settlement amount than is warranted. In these situations an attorney will advise the client to reject the offer and proceed to trial.

    A lawsuit can be a long process and requires a significant amount of time and money to prepare for. An experienced lawyer will make sure that their clients are aware of each step in the process and keep them informed of any developments. They will also assist the victims and their loved ones in obtaining medical care as well as any other financial support they may require.

    Mesothelioma lawyers will try to speed up the legal process, even if the defendants try to delay the proceedings. It is crucial that potential victims and their families make a claim before the statute of limitations expires. A knowledgeable lawyer will be able to avoid this mistake and will assist them in filing a lawsuit before it's late.

    There are a variety of different kinds of mesothelioma lawsuits victims and their families can file. Personal injury, wrongful death, and trust funds are all feasible claims. Most mesothelioma cases are filed individually, rather than in an action that is a class. This is due to the fact that it has been proven that mesothelioma patients receive more compensation in individual lawsuits than from class action settlements. Once a lawsuit has been settled, the money will be paid out to plaintiffs. If medical professionals have imposed liens, these must be paid prior to the funds being released.

    Finding the financial support you need

    The financial assistance you require can help ease your anxiety during treatment, pay for medical expenses and make ends meet. Mesothelioma compensation may assist you in paying for your past and future care medical bills, legal costs and lost wages, the loss of capacity to earn, pain and suffering, and other damages. The amount you can receive depends on your state and kind of mesothelioma you have. There are three types of mesothelioma lawsuits that include personal injury, wrongful deaths, and trust fund claim. A personal injury lawsuit seeks compensation from the person who caused the illness. This is the most common type of mesothelioma lawsuit. Patients' families may claim wrongful deaths to get compensation from the company(ies) responsible for the victim’s death.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ma fund is filed at one of the many asbestos trust funds established by asbestos companies or the government.

    It could take years to settle a lawsuit. A fair settlement can be difficult to negotiate. Some asbestos companies will try to delay the process by filing frivolous lawsuits. Your mesothelioma lawyer is skilled in recognizing and countering these strategies.

    Depending on where you reside, which kind of mesothelioma do you have, and the time you were exposed to asbestos, there are different statutes of limitations that apply to your particular case. Some states have shorter statutes of limitations, while others have longer periods of time to bring a lawsuit.

    A mesothelioma case can last for several years. Judges can accelerate the trial in cases where the plaintiff has a very short life expectancy or is in a grave health condition. The presiding judge will determine whether there is a need to speed up the trial and will require the defendant to respond to any claims made by the plaintiff.

    The VA healthcare system can provide veterans with access to the top mesothelioma physicians in the nation and disability compensation. The VA provides specialized nursing services for mesothelioma patients. Mesothelioma attorneys can explain how you can combine the advantages of both programs to get the most payout.
